Lavender Orpingtons

I just love to watch my farm animals wander through the homestead, especially the chickens.  I have quite a few breeds running around here, and thanks to my friends at Rock Ridge Farms Rare Chickens, my collection now includes Lavender Orpingtons!  It all started with a brainstorm during a snowstorm.  Last year while snowed in yet again, I consoled myself by dreaming up new garden plans.  I decided that when spring hit, I would expand my lavender patch to the slope below the barn.  I was brainstorming ideas for the design, when it hit me.  What's the perfect accessory for a lavender patch?  Lavender Orpingtons, I say!  I immediately knew who could help.  I called up Mr. Rock Ridge himself and explained my situation.  And before I knew it, I was the proud owner of a flock of stunningly smokey lavender beauties.  When spring rolled around, I got right to work planting the new lavender patch.  It's had a year to get established, and if all goes as planned, I'll have my Lavender Orpingtons wandering through it by early summer.  I'm so excited, I think I'll squeal with delight!
